After Effects includes several built-in keying effects, as well as the Academy Award-winning Keylight effect, which excels at professional-quality color keying.
Though the color keying effects built into After Effects can be useful for some purposes, you should try keying with Keylight before attempting to use these built-in keying effects. To key well-lit footage shot against a color screen, start with the Color Difference Key. A hold-out matte is a masked-out portion of a duplicate of a layer that you have keyed.
